Will Taylor Swift Attend the Chiefs-Lions Game on Aug. 17 to Cheer on Travis Kelce?

On Saturday, Aug. 17, the Kansas City Chiefs face off against the Detroit Lions during a home preseason game at Arrowhead Stadium. The real question on the minds of Taylor Swift fans, however, is: Will the pop superstar be there cheering on her boyfriend, Travis Kelce?

Unfortunately for Swifties hoping to catch a glimpse of the "Cruel Summer" singer supporting her tight end beau, Swift will not attend the matchup. That's because she will perform her third consecutive Eras Tour show at Wembley Stadium in London, England.

The Chiefs-Lions game will kick off at 3 p.m. CT on Saturday. So even with London time being six hours ahead—and Swift taking the Eras Tour stage at roughly 7 p.m. local time—she still wouldn't be able to swing it.

Swift similarly missed the Chiefs' first preseason game against the Jacksonville Jaguars on Aug. 10.

It's worth noting the "Fortnight" songstress could potentially attend the Chiefs' next preseason game on Aug. 22. After Saturday, Swift will play two more shows in London—Aug. 19 and Aug. 20—before enjoying an extended break from touring. So she should be free, barring any non-Eras-Tour-related schedule conflicts.

The next Chiefs matchup (the first regular season game) is a home game on Sept. 5 against the Baltimore Ravens, which Swift can likely also attend. After that, any Chiefs matchups through September and including Oct. 7 are all potential events for Swift sightings.

On Oct. 18, Swift will resume Eras Tour shows in Miami, Fla., before traveling to New Orleans and Indianapolis. After that, the 34-year-old will head to Toronto and Vancouver in Canada, wrapping up her wildly popular tour on Dec. 8.
